I have Dell with an Radeon X600 with 256 Mb of RAM. I upgraded from Win XP
SP2 to Vista RTM. When it boot, I could not see anything and it would display
"out of frequency". This was very scarry as I could do nothing without seeing.
For a plug and play environment I was very disapointed to see this happen.
And I consider myself a pretty savy computer engineer.
The computer would reboot, but even pressing F8, it would not give me a menu.

I had numerous failed attempts to go into safe mode and change the
resolution to a low resolution, update the video driver and so on. At last, I
spoke to my MS friend and he pointed out that ATI has a beta driver. ALthough
he was skeptical that the Windows driver did not work, he suggested to try
downloading the beta.
vuala. I can now see.......
